Formula 1 – This is the Right Formula of understanding the Carpet Area.
This is in case you have 2 Areas with you – One being the Built Up or Chargeable and the Second being the Carpet Area. (Which is usually available. In case there is no Built Up Area and if the builder is only selling on Carpet Areas then of course there is no loading.)
Chargeable Area – 1000
Carpet Area – 650
Difference – 350
Formula is the Difference Divided by Carpet Area For Example – 350 / 650 = The Loading = 53% Which means the loaded area is 53% on Top of the Carpet Area.
Formula 2 – Builders/owners Version when they say Difference between chargeable and carpet area – then what they mean??
Let us say builder says 35% is the difference.
1000 – 35.0% – 650 Carpet
So in short, you should never ask what is the difference, you should ask what is the loading on Top of the Carpet as that is the only and correct way of understanding the correct area and then you can see the price based on the carpet area.
